Nobody said it was the only option, but it's by far the most accessible for most students.

AURORA is only an option for incoming Freshman, and to become a guide, you have to get hired for it. It's very competitive, and to get the job you are required to take a class, hope you get picked from that, and then make sure you have availability in August to train and guide the trips, which doesn't work with most of our summer internships and jobs

Shaver's Creek isn't some place you just can just show up at and participate. You pretty much have to be an RPTM major to get involved there. And that isn't outdoor rec.

Adventure Rec trips are so fucking expensive this year that most students can't afford them, and the ones who can don't even get to do the trips because they always get cancelled due to not enough signups

If youre a non-RPTM major who is looking for a network of friends for gettin' after it outdoors on a student budget, there arent other options besides PSOC. That was the whole point of PSOC. You didn't have to be rich or an RPTM major or a paid guide to be a part of it
